Adding Video using HTML5: Example: This simple example illustrates the use of the <video> tag in HTML. As a result you'll get an html page with all necessary code, images, and videos. The newly introduced HTML5 <video> element provides a standard way to embed video in web pages. <script>. If height and width are not set, the page might flicker while the video loads. The Limitations HTML 5 Video and Full Screen Issues. With the introduction of HTML5, you can now place videos directly into the page itself. Since the canvas comes first in the document, it'll be behind the video, exactly where we want it. Hover over the indicator to reveal the controls to accelerate, slowdown, or rewind the video (10 seconds + lowers playback speed). With the introduction of HTML 5, the audio tag provides a simple way to play audio files without the use of Adobe Flash. Because every (milli)second counts. The Vimeo video player supports the following: Analytics; Embeddable playlists; Shareable video pages; Skinning and customization of HTML5 video controls; 4K and HDR (for a charge) HTML5 video live-streaming (for a charge) HTML5 Videos are a convenient and effective way to display videos on any website. Select Save Snapshot As… if you only want to save the video snapshot. That behavior corresponds to an autohide setting of 1. There are encoding issues, format issues, device issues, filesize issues, …. Firt off, let's take a piece of straightforward code for embedding a . Responsive HTML5 Video Player. HTML5 players now always use the dark theme. Jan 23, 2018. After many tests I gave up. Our web development and design tutorials, courses, and books will teach you HTML, CSS, JavaScript, PHP, Python, and more. 4: height. This page demonstrates the new HTML5 video element, its media API, and the media events. In other words, it will scale to fit its container at the video's intrinsic aspect ratio, or at a specified aspectRatio . Note: Do not rescale video with the height and width attributes! However GIFs are a terrible format for storing video and are often huge in size leading to slow page load times and high data usage. Introducing the New <VIDEO> Element. You can draw any kind of control you like on the canvas, and use the techniques described in Responding to Mouse and Touch Events on Canvas to determine if the input is on your custom control, but there is a faster and better way to implement most custom controls.. This attribute specifies the height of the video's display area, in CSS pixels. I'm trying to place a video in a HTML5 banner using the video component, but when I resize the component to fit the canvas, the controls and the video resize to a different size when I preview the banner/video. This will embed a video, complete with controls, in browsers that support the HTML5 video tag and the video content type. Poster: It loads an image to preview before the loading of the video. The easiest way to embed a video in your web page is to include the HTML5 <video> element with the controls attribute. This time, however, I'm going to talk about video streaming! Get Started with Custom HTML5 Video Controls. By David Walsh on November 7, 2012. Showing or hiding the video player's controls. 100s of plugins Plus, with the ever growing number of portable devices including iOS, Android, and now Windows phones, the problem is just growing in complexity. See the effect on the video and on the underlying events and properties. HTML5 video players only need you to use the video element. Before HTML5, in order to have a video play on a webpage, you would need to use a plugin like Adobe Flash Player. It is always recommended to add HTML5 video controls to your player. Video Controls. Play, pause, and seek in the entire video, change the volume, mute, change the playback rate (including going into negative values). Luckily, HTML5 media elements (audio and video) support for media elements API, which we can access using JavaScript and use them to wire up our HTML5 video controls.. Before get started with coding, let me briefly explain about jQuery video element targeting.. This is all experimental technology until some new JavaScript methods become standardized. Also, if the <video> element has the "vjs-fluid" , this option is automatically set to true . To make an HTML5 video responsive is a little more complex than an image. Lesson Code: http://www.developphp.com/video/JavaScript/Video-Player-Custom-Controls-Programming-TutorialIn this first part of the tutorial series we will di. HTML5 video portability is still a very difficult matter. Once the extension is installed simply navigate to any page that offers HTML5 video, and you'll see a speed indicator in top left corner of the video player. However, the video element is relatively new, but it works in most of the modern web browsers. The method for getting access to camera was initially navigator.getUserMedianavigator.mediaDevices.getUserMedia. If this attribute is present, it will allow the user to control video playback, including volume, seeking, and pause/resume playback. This Boolean attribute if specified, will allow video automatically seek back to the start after . HTML5 Video and Background Images « Back 19 March 2013. video popup.js is a lightweight video lightbox plugin which displays and plays your HTML5 video and Youtube video in a responsive, configurable modal popup. It is always recommended to add HTML5 video controls to your player. Safari honors the preload="metadata" attribute, allowing <video> and <audio> elements to load enough media data to determine that media's size, duration, and available tracks. Autoplay, loop and mute. HTML5 video opens up a lot of cool new opportunities for developers. Explanation: The poster attribute of the video tag contains the URL of the image that the user wants to set as the thumbnail of the video which is the image that will be visible until the user press the play button. However, by default, these videos contain built-in controls (like play, mute, volume, etc.) To scale the Iframe embed or HTML5 video, Both need a different technique to handle their responsiveness. The player looks great out of the box, but can be easily styled with a little bit of extra CSS. Because Video.js decorates an HTML5 <video> element, many of the options available are also available as standard <video> tag attributes: <video controls autoplay preload="auto" .>. HTML5 video has the same syntax as HTML5 audio, but tends to have greater engagement with visitors.. Recently I was building a one page site, the centre piece of which was a video. To save a video file from a web page to your computer: Right-click. More than just the best video player. Press "Start". HTML5 Video Events and API. document.addEventListener('DOMContentLoaded', function() {. The best way to deliver a good video experience to everybody without loosing your sanity is to use a third party service like YouTube or Vimeo. All we can do is to specify the controls attribute and the browser will do the rest.. For example: in Firefox (v59b when this is written) the controls will fade out when mouse is outside the element when the video is playing even if the controls attribute is set - they will show if not playing, kind of the . Video Controls. In HTML5 players, the video progress bar and player controls display or hide automatically. The HTML 5 <video> tag is used to specify video on an HTML document. Set the width and height for the video size and control attributes to add functions such as play and pause or set up the video to play automatically. The <source> element allows you to specify alternative video files which the browser may choose from.
Radio Caroline Djs From The 1970s, Are Foot Peels Safe For Diabetics, Opp Accident Reports Bruce County, Collect Sentence For Class 5, London Mayor Niko Omilana, Dignitaries Pronunciation, Prediabetes Neuropathy Treatment, Moist Chocolate Muffin Recipe, Emerica Wino G6 Slip-on Brown, Bbis Berlin Brandenburg International School, Crank Brothers Eggbeater, Famous Footballer From Swindon, Michael Jackson Purple Hat, Royal Rose Hotel Abu Dhabi Address, Weather Auckland, New Zealand,